Treak Cliff Cavern at Castleton has been a working Blue John mine since 1750 and open to the public as a visitor attraction since 1935. Visitors can see some of the finest stalactites and stalagmites in the Peak District whilst also experiencing the beauty of Blue John Stone. The largest areas of Blue John Stone ever revealed can be fully appreciated by the light of newly installed spotlights. The largest single piece ever discovered can still be seen in situ. This underground wonderland also contains thousands of stalactites and stalagmites plus all kinds of rocks, minerals and fossils. Multi coloured flowstone covers the walls of Aladdin's cave, whilst the most famous formation is The Stork, standing on one leg. The Cavern is enjoyed by visitors of all ages from all over the world.
